Why Families Are Choosing 24-Hour Home Assistance

Caring for an elderly family member often comes with emotional and physical challenges. Many families struggle to balance caregiving responsibilities with work, parenting, and personal time. That’s where 24-hour home care in Orange County steps in to make a lasting difference.

Unlike part-time or hourly care, 24-hour home assistance ensures continuous monitoring and support. Whether it’s help with daily activities, medication reminders, mobility assistance, or emotional companionship, these caregivers provide complete peace of mind both for seniors and their families.

Key benefits include:

  • Constant supervision and immediate response to emergencies.
  • Personalized care plans tailored to each senior’s health needs.
  • Emotional companionship that combats loneliness and isolation.
  • Reduced hospital readmissions through proactive wellness monitoring.

This level of care helps seniors live safely and comfortably in their own homeswithout sacrificing their dignity or independence.

How Technology Is Enhancing Home Care

The future of elder care isn’t just about compassionate service it’s also about innovation. In Orange County, many home care providers are adopting technology to improve efficiency, safety, and personalization.

Some advancements include:

  • Smart monitoring systems: Devices that detect falls, track movements, and alert caregivers instantly.
  • Telehealth and virtual visits: Allowing doctors to monitor seniors’ health remotely, reducing the need for frequent hospital trips.
  • Medication management apps: Helping caregivers ensure timely and accurate medication administration.
  • Digital care plans: Families can now track their loved one’s daily routines, meals, and activities in real time.

These innovations bridge the gap between medical care and emotional support, creating a seamless ecosystem of safety and trust for aging adults.

The Emotional Side of 24-Hour Care

While technology adds convenience, the emotional element remains at the heart of quality elder care. Seniors often face feelings of isolation, especially when mobility declines or loved ones live far away. A dedicated 24-hour caregiver doesn’t just assist with physical needs they offer companionship, empathy, and human connection.

This continuous emotional support reduces stress, anxiety, and depression among elderly individuals. In many cases, seniors under consistent home care show improved cognitive function, better nutrition, and overall happiness.

Orange County families are increasingly realizing that elder care is not just about extending life it’s about enriching it.
